Genel Hosting Web Hosting

HTTP/2 ve HTTP/3 Performans Karşılaştırması

HTTP/2 ve HTTP/3 Performans Karşılaştırması

HTTP/2 ve HTTP/3 Performans Karşılaştırması

Web performansı ve sunucu optimizasyonu, modern uygulama ve web geliştiricileri için kritik öneme sahiptir. Bu bağlamda, HTTP protokolünün geliştirilmesi ve iyileştirilmesi oldukça önem kazanmıştır. HTTP/2 ve HTTP/3, web iletişiminin daha hızlı ve verimli hale gelmesi için geliştirilmiş protokollerdir. Bu yazıda, HTTP/2 ve HTTP/3'''ün performans karşılaştırmasını ve hangi durumlarda hangi protokolün daha uygun olabileceğini detaylı bir şekilde inceleyeceğiz.

HTTP/2'''nin Özellikleri

HTTP/2, HTTP/1.1'''in sınırlamalarını aşmak amacıyla geliştirilmiştir. En dikkat çekici özelliklerinden biri, veri paketlerinin aynı anda gönderilip alınmasına olanak tanıyan çoklu bağlantı (multiplexing) özelliğidir. Bu özellik, yüzlerce kaynağın eşzamanlı olarak yüklenmesine izin vererek sayfa yükleme sürelerini önemli ölçüde azaltmaktadır.

Diğer özellikleri arasında öne çıkanlar:

Başlık sıkıştırma: HTTP/2, başlık verilerini sıkıştırarak verimliliği artırır.
Akış kontrolü: Sunucu ve istemci arasındaki veri iletimini optimize eder.
Önceliklendirme: Hangi verilerin önce aktarılacağını belirlemeye olanak tanır.

Bu özellikler, özellikle yoğun trafik alan web hosting servislerinde oldukça faydalıdır.

HTTP/3'''ün Yenilikleri

HTTP/3, temelde HTTP/2 üzerinde yapılandırılmıştır, ancak en önemli farkı UDP protokolü üzerine inşa edilmiş olmasıdır. Bu yeni protokolün getirdiği en büyük avantaj, TCP'''nin sınırlamalarını ortadan kaldırmaktır. TCP, bağlantı başlatma gecikmelerine ve paket kaybı yaşandığında tüm bağlantının yavaşlamasına neden olabilir. HTTP/3, bu sorunları UDP temelli bir yapı kullanarak çözer.

Öne çıkan HTTP/3 özellikleri:

Hızlı bağlantı kurulumu: QUIC protokolü sayesinde daha hızlı bağlantı başlatma.
Azaltılmış gecikme süreleri: Düşük gecikme süreleri sunar ve özellikle mobil cihazlarda önemli performans iyileştirmeleri sağlar.
Bağlantı güvenliği: Daha gelişmiş güvenlik protokolleri ile entegre çalışır.

HTTP/3, özellikle dünya genelinde cloud sunucu hizmetleri sunan firmalar için avantajlı olabilir, çünkü daha hızlı veri erişimi ve yük dengeleme sağlar.

Performans Kıyaslaması

HTTP/2 ve HTTP/3 arasındaki performans farkları, farklı kullanım senaryolarında farklı sonuçlar verebilir. Genel olarak:

HTTP/2, daha eski ve daha yaygın olduğundan dolayı birçok eski sistemle uyumludur ve birçok web hizmeti için yeterli performansı sunar. Özellikle veri paketlerinin çokluluk özelliği, HTTP/2'''nin en belirgin avantajlarından biridir.

HTTP/3, daha yeni bir protokol olduğu için optimizasyonu ve adaptasyonu vardır. Bağlantıların daha hızlı başlatılması ve azalan gecikme süreleri ile HTTP/3, gelecekte web trafiği için standart haline gelebilir. Bununla birlikte, birçok platform henüz bu protokolü tam anlamıyla desteklememektedir.

HTTP/2 ve HTTP/3, her ikisi de web tarayıcı ve sunucu arasında daha verimli veri iletimi sağlıyor olsa da, dedicated sunucu kullananlar için HTTP/3'''ün sunduğu düşük gecikme süreleri önemli farklar yaratabilir.

Sonuçta…

Genel olarak, HTTP/2 ve HTTP/3, web performansını artırmak için iki güçlü araçtır. HTTP/2'''nin yaygın benimsenmesi ve HTTP/3'''ün yenilikçi protokolü, farklı proje ve sunucu gereksinimleri için uygun stratejiler geliştirmeyi mümkün kılmaktadır. Özellikle, yüksek performans isteyen uygulamalar için söz konusu protokollerin avantajları dikkate alınmalıdır. Hosting çözümleri sunduğumuz farklı WordPress Hosting ve benzeri hizmetlerde hangi protokole ihtiyaç duyduğunuzu değerlendirerek doğru tercihleri yapmanız, kullanıcı deneyimini olumlu yönde etkileyecektir.